以苏州某工程为实例,通过在转换构件内布设钢筋测力计,现场量测钢筋的应力、应变情况,并对施工全过程进行跟踪;采用ANSYS进行分层加载模拟计算并与实测结果进行对比分析,对有限元分析和设计的安全性、可靠性、正确性进行评价。箱形转换构件的现场实测在国内尚属首例,可为今后类似工程设计提供借鉴,为完善相关设计规范提供部分理论依据。
